Medical Malpractice

Medical malpractice occurs when a healthcare professional fails to provide the appropriate standard of care to a patient, resulting in injury or death. Medical malpractice cases can be complex and challenging, as they often involve complex medical issues and require expert testimony. The legal process for personal injury cases in Philadelphia involves several stages. Firstly, the injured party must file a complaint with the court, outlining the details of their injuries and the damages they are seeking. The defendant then has a certain amount of time to file a response, admitting or denying the allegations.

Once the pleadings are complete, the discovery phase begins. During this phase, both parties exchange information and documents relevant to the case. This may include medical records, witness statements, and expert reports. The discovery process helps both sides prepare for trial and identify any potential weaknesses in their case.

If the case cannot be settled during the discovery phase, it will proceed to trial. At trial, both sides will present their evidence and arguments to a jury. The jury will then deliberate and decide whether the defendant is liable for the plaintiff’s injuries. If the jury finds the defendant liable, they will award damages to the plaintiff.

Negotiation

Negotiation is an important part of the personal injury process. Most cases are settled without going to trial. During negotiation, the plaintiff’s attorney will present a demand package to the defendant’s insurance company. The demand package will Artikel the plaintiff’s injuries, damages, and the amount of compensation they are seeking.

The insurance company will then evaluate the demand package and make a counteroffer. The parties will then negotiate back and forth until they reach a settlement agreement.

Mediation

If the parties cannot reach a settlement agreement during negotiation, they may choose to participate in mediation. Mediation is a process in which a neutral third party helps the parties to resolve their dispute. The mediator will meet with the parties separately and then together to help them reach a compromise.

Trial

If the parties cannot reach a settlement agreement during negotiation or mediation, the case will proceed to trial. At trial, the plaintiff will have the burden of proving that the defendant is liable for their injuries. The defendant will have the opportunity to present a defense.

The jury will then deliberate and decide whether the defendant is liable. If the jury finds the defendant liable, they will award damages to the plaintiff.
